The Importance of CA Certificates in Browsers: Ensuring Secure Online Transactions

The internet has become an integral part of our daily lives, with millions of people around the world relying on it for various purposes, including online banking, shopping, and communication. However, the convenience and accessibility of the internet also come with significant security risks. One of the key measures to mitigate these risks is the use of Certificate Authority (CA) certificates, which play a crucial role in ensuring the authenticity and security of online transactions. In this article, we will delve into the significance of CA certificates being contained in the browser and explore their importance in maintaining a secure online environment.

Introduction to CA Certificates

CA certificates are digital certificates issued by a trusted Certificate Authority (CA) to verify the identity of an organization or individual. These certificates contain the public key and identity information of the certificate holder, such as their name, address, and domain name. The primary function of a CA certificate is to establish trust between a website and its users, ensuring that the website is genuine and not a phishing or malware site. CA certificates are essential for secure online transactions, as they enable browsers to verify the identity of a website and ensure that the connection is encrypted and secure.

How CA Certificates Work

When a user visits a website, the browser checks the website’s CA certificate to verify its identity. The browser then checks the certificate against a list of trusted CA certificates stored in its database. If the certificate is trusted, the browser will display a padlock icon in the address bar, indicating that the connection is secure. The CA certificate is used to establish an encrypted connection between the browser and the website, using the public key contained in the certificate. This ensures that any data exchanged between the browser and the website remains confidential and cannot be intercepted or tampered with by unauthorized parties.

Types of CA Certificates

There are several types of CA certificates, each with its own unique characteristics and uses. The most common types of CA certificates include:

Domain Validation (DV) certificates, which verify the domain name of a website
Organization Validation (OV) certificates, which verify the identity of an organization
Extended Validation (EV) certificates, which provide an additional layer of verification and security
Wildcard certificates, which allow a single certificate to secure multiple subdomains

The Significance of CA Certificates in Browsers

CA certificates are stored in the browser’s database, known as the trust store. The trust store contains a list of trusted CA certificates, which are used to verify the identity of websites. The presence of a CA certificate in the browser’s trust store is essential for establishing trust between a website and its users. When a user visits a website, the browser checks the website’s CA certificate against the list of trusted certificates in the trust store. If the certificate is trusted, the browser will display a padlock icon in the address bar, indicating that the connection is secure.

Benefits of CA Certificates in Browsers

The presence of CA certificates in browsers provides several benefits, including:

Enhanced security: CA certificates ensure that the connection between the browser and the website is encrypted and secure, protecting user data from interception and tampering.
Authentication: CA certificates verify the identity of a website, ensuring that users are not redirected to a phishing or malware site.
Trust: CA certificates establish trust between a website and its users, increasing user confidence and loyalty.
Compliance: CA certificates are required for compliance with various regulations, such as the Payment Card Industry Data Security Standard (PCI DSS) and the General Data Protection Regulation (GDPR).

Consequences of Not Having a CA Certificate

Not having a CA certificate can have significant consequences, including:

Security risks: Without a CA certificate, the connection between the browser and the website is not encrypted, leaving user data vulnerable to interception and tampering.
Loss of trust: Users may lose trust in a website that does not have a CA certificate, leading to a decline in user engagement and loyalty.
Non-compliance: Not having a CA certificate can result in non-compliance with various regulations, leading to fines and penalties.

Best Practices for CA Certificates

To ensure the effective use of CA certificates, it is essential to follow best practices, including:

Regularly updating CA certificates: CA certificates should be updated regularly to ensure that they remain valid and trusted.
Using trusted CA certificates: Only trusted CA certificates should be used, as untrusted certificates can compromise security and trust.
Monitoring CA certificate expiration: CA certificates should be monitored for expiration, as expired certificates can compromise security and trust.

Conclusion

In conclusion, CA certificates are a crucial component of online security, ensuring that the connection between a browser and a website is encrypted and secure. The presence of a CA certificate in the browser’s trust store is essential for establishing trust between a website and its users. By understanding the significance of CA certificates and following best practices, organizations can ensure the security and trust of their online transactions, protecting user data and maintaining compliance with various regulations. CA certificates are a vital tool in the fight against cybercrime, and their importance cannot be overstated. As the internet continues to evolve, the role of CA certificates will become even more critical, ensuring that online transactions remain secure and trustworthy.

CA Certificate TypeDescription
Domain Validation (DV)Verifies the domain name of a website
Organization Validation (OV)Verifies the identity of an organization
Extended Validation (EV)Provides an additional layer of verification and security
WildcardAllows a single certificate to secure multiple subdomains
  • CA certificates ensure the authenticity and security of online transactions
  • CA certificates establish trust between a website and its users
  • CA certificates are required for compliance with various regulations
  • CA certificates should be regularly updated and monitored for expiration

What are CA certificates and how do they work?

CA certificates, also known as Certificate Authority certificates, are digital certificates issued by a trusted third-party organization, known as a Certificate Authority (CA). These certificates play a crucial role in establishing secure online transactions by verifying the identity of websites and ensuring that the data exchanged between the website and the user’s browser remains encrypted and protected from interception. When a website obtains a CA certificate, it is essentially obtaining a digital stamp of approval that confirms its identity and authenticity.

The CA certificate works by using a complex algorithm to encrypt the data exchanged between the website and the user’s browser. This encryption process ensures that even if the data is intercepted, it cannot be read or deciphered without the decryption key. The CA certificate also contains the website’s public key, which is used to establish a secure connection with the user’s browser. When a user visits a website with a valid CA certificate, the browser checks the certificate to ensure it is valid and trusted, and then uses the public key to establish a secure connection, thereby ensuring a safe and secure online transaction.

Why are CA certificates essential for secure online transactions?

CA certificates are essential for secure online transactions because they provide a way to verify the identity of websites and ensure that the data exchanged between the website and the user’s browser remains encrypted and protected. Without a CA certificate, a website’s identity cannot be verified, and the data exchanged between the website and the user’s browser may be vulnerable to interception and eavesdropping. This can lead to a range of security risks, including identity theft, financial fraud, and data breaches. By obtaining a CA certificate, a website can demonstrate its commitment to security and provide users with a safe and secure online experience.

The importance of CA certificates cannot be overstated, as they provide a critical layer of security and trust in online transactions. By verifying the identity of websites and ensuring the encryption of data, CA certificates help to prevent a range of cyber threats, including phishing attacks, man-in-the-middle attacks, and malware infections. Furthermore, CA certificates are an essential requirement for websites that handle sensitive information, such as financial institutions, e-commerce sites, and healthcare organizations. By prioritizing the use of CA certificates, these organizations can help to protect their users’ sensitive information and maintain the trust and confidence of their customers.

How do browsers verify CA certificates?

Browsers verify CA certificates by checking the certificate’s validity, ensuring it has not expired, and verifying the identity of the website. This process involves checking the certificate’s digital signature, which is created using the CA’s private key, and verifying that the signature matches the certificate’s contents. The browser also checks the certificate’s chain of trust, which involves verifying the identity of the CA that issued the certificate and ensuring that the CA is trusted by the browser. If the certificate is valid and trusted, the browser will establish a secure connection with the website, and the user will see a padlock icon or other indicator of a secure connection.

The browser’s verification process typically involves the following steps: checking the certificate’s subject and issuer fields to ensure they match the website’s domain name and the CA’s identity; verifying the certificate’s validity period to ensure it has not expired; checking the certificate’s revocation status to ensure it has not been revoked; and verifying the certificate’s chain of trust to ensure the CA is trusted by the browser. If any of these checks fail, the browser will display a warning message or error, indicating that the website’s identity cannot be verified or that the connection is not secure. By verifying CA certificates in this way, browsers help to ensure that users can trust the websites they visit and that their online transactions are secure.

What happens if a website’s CA certificate is not trusted?

If a website’s CA certificate is not trusted, the browser will display a warning message or error, indicating that the website’s identity cannot be verified or that the connection is not secure. This can occur if the certificate has expired, has been revoked, or if the CA that issued the certificate is not trusted by the browser. In some cases, the browser may also block access to the website or prevent the user from proceeding with the transaction. This is because an untrusted CA certificate can indicate a potential security risk, such as a phishing attack or a man-in-the-middle attack.

If a website’s CA certificate is not trusted, the website’s owner should take immediate action to resolve the issue. This may involve obtaining a new CA certificate from a trusted CA, renewing an expired certificate, or correcting any errors or inconsistencies in the certificate’s contents. In the meantime, users should exercise caution when visiting the website and avoid entering sensitive information, such as passwords or credit card numbers. By prioritizing the use of trusted CA certificates, websites can help to maintain the trust and confidence of their users and ensure a safe and secure online experience.

Can CA certificates be used for other purposes besides secure online transactions?

Yes, CA certificates can be used for other purposes besides secure online transactions. For example, CA certificates can be used to authenticate the identity of devices, such as laptops or mobile devices, and to ensure that they are authorized to access a network or system. CA certificates can also be used to sign software and other digital content, ensuring that it has not been tampered with or altered during transmission. Additionally, CA certificates can be used to establish secure connections between devices, such as between a laptop and a wireless network, or between a mobile device and a cloud service.

The use of CA certificates for purposes other than secure online transactions is becoming increasingly common, as organizations seek to leverage the security and trust provided by these certificates to protect their devices, data, and systems. For example, the Internet of Things (IoT) industry is increasingly using CA certificates to authenticate the identity of devices and ensure that they are secure and trustworthy. Similarly, the software industry is using CA certificates to sign software and ensure that it is genuine and has not been tampered with. By using CA certificates in these ways, organizations can help to maintain the security and integrity of their systems and data, and provide users with a safe and secure experience.

How can users ensure that their browser is configured to trust CA certificates?

Users can ensure that their browser is configured to trust CA certificates by checking the browser’s settings and ensuring that the CA certificates are installed and trusted. This typically involves checking the browser’s list of trusted CAs and ensuring that the CAs that issued the website’s CA certificate are included in the list. Users can also check the browser’s certificate store to ensure that the website’s CA certificate is installed and trusted. Additionally, users should keep their browser and operating system up to date, as newer versions often include updated lists of trusted CAs and improved certificate validation mechanisms.

To configure their browser to trust CA certificates, users should follow these steps: open the browser’s settings or preferences; navigate to the security or advanced settings; check the list of trusted CAs and ensure that the CAs that issued the website’s CA certificate are included; check the certificate store to ensure that the website’s CA certificate is installed and trusted; and update the browser and operating system to ensure that the latest security patches and updates are installed. By taking these steps, users can help to ensure that their browser is configured to trust CA certificates and that their online transactions are secure and protected.

Leave a Comment